Default Re: Global spell tactics ?

Globals are a long investment, like Clamming.
Only they're easily "killable".
Some globals are very powerful, like Arcane Nexus, and Forge of the Ancients. Some others are aimed only, like Purgatory.
Others aren't so good because they could be useful to you, but damage many other players, so they're so rarely casted. (like Second Sun)

About dispelling, the two most important thing are:
Dispel is anonimous.
Dispel could be cast in "communion".

Personally I try to shoot down Forge of the Ancients and Arcane Nexus if I see them casted, even if I'm at peace with that nation.
However I've to use my gems, and it could happen that your resources are needed for something else (like you're at war with Ermor and you need harbingers and such stuff).

If you're at peace, I try always to get 1 gem producing spell that isn't Spell Focus (it gives a too low gem income, but I can think about too if nothing else is avaiable).
